What Does Dress Your Age Mean?

The phrase "dress your age" is often used to describe a way of dressing that is appropriate for your stage in life. In other words, it's age-appropriate men's fashion. It's about choosing clothes and styles that are suitable for the age group you belong to.

This doesn't mean that you have to dress like everyone else in your age group or that you can never experiment with fashion. But it does mean being aware of the overall look you're going for and making sure that your age reflects that.

For example, if you're in your 20s, you might want to experiment with flashy styles and trends. But as you get older, you'll probably want to gravitate toward a more classic look that shows your experience in the world of fashion and style.

Stick to Classic Clothing Ensembles

One of the best ways to dress your age is to stick to classic looks. This doesn't mean that you can't experiment, but it's best to focus on pieces that will stand the test of time. Classic pieces only get better with age and can be mixed and matched to create endless outfit possibilities.

So, what exactly counts as a "classic" piece?

Some examples of classic clothing items include:

  • A well-tailored blazer
  • A crisp white shirt
  • A tailored pair of trousers
  • A cashmere sweater
  • A bespoke suit

These are just a few examples, but you get the idea. The goal is to focus on clothing items that are well-made, stylish, and will never go out of fashion.

Dress for Your Body Type

It's also important to dress for your body type. If you're not sure what silhouette works best for you, it's a good idea to consult a professional.

Once you know which styles flatter your figure, you can start to build a wardrobe that makes the most of your natural assets. If you're broad-shouldered, for example, you might want to stay away from slim-fitting tops and opt for something that will balance your proportions.

On the other hand, and if you're plus-size, you'll want to find pieces that highlight your best features while providing ample coverage.

Tight Fitting Clothes

As we age, our bodies change shape and size. It's important to dress for the body you have now, not the body you had in your 20s. Tight fits are also not the ideal look for a professional, middle-aged man. Leave the skinny fits for the younger, inexperienced men.

That means avoiding tight-fitting clothes that are uncomfortable and unflattering. Instead, opt for clothing that is snug, comfortable, and compliments your body. A classic-fitting shirt and pair of pants will do the trick.

Matching Colors

When you were younger, you probably felt the need to match everything. Your tie had to match your shirt; your socks had to match your pants, and so on. But as you get older, you'll start to realize that matching isn't a must.

Don't be afraid to mix different colors and patterns. As long as the items complement each other, you'll break any stereotypes placed on your age group. There's no reason middle-aged men can't dress boldly.

In fact, sometimes it's more interesting to mix and match different colors and patterns. So don't be afraid to experiment with different color combinations. Your mid-forties are the perfect time to start getting more playful with tie patterns too.
